Responsibilities
Lancaster Behavioral Health Hospital (LBHH) is a 126-bed, inpatient psychiatric hospital and start-up joint venture between Lancaster General Health/Penn Medicine and Universal Health Services.
In addition to a general adult unit and dedicated adolescent unit, the facility offers services for treating those with co-occurring disorders on the psychiatric-medical unit, an intensive adult unit to care for those with severe conditions, as well as a women’s trauma unit.
How will you make a difference at LBHH?
Family Medicine Physicians at Lancaster Behavioral Health Hospital deliver quality care to patients with varying psychiatric, behavioral and mental health diagnoses, ensuring their safety and continued care.
A Family Medicine Physician are responsible for completing the following duties and tasks:
As available, reviews the results of prior examinations and psychiatric evaluations, tests, and treatment.
Makes of confirms diagnosis of an individual’s treatment needs.
Obtains comprehensive health history; perform physical examination on new admissions and document/dictate in patient record if applicable.
Discusses findings of examinations and tests with the individual, his or her family, and treatment team members.
Perform and/or participate in rounds of hospitalized patients, including physical assessments, interpretation of diagnostic studies, interaction with nursing staff and documentation in medical record.

Located in Aiken, South Carolina, which was named 2018’s “Best Small Town in the South” by Southern Living Magazine, Aiken Regional Medical Centers is a 273 licensed-bed acute care facility that offers a comprehensive range of specialties and services. Aiken Regional is dedicated to patient safety and providing quality healthcare services, many of which are recognized on a state, regional or national level including a Certified Primary Heart Attack Center, a Certified Primary Stroke Center and an Advanced Heart Failure Certification from The Joint Commission® and American Heart Association®.
Aiken Regional receives more than 42,000 emergency room visits, performs nearly 9,000 surgeries and delivers over 1,100 babies each year. More than 1,200 associates, a medical staff of more than 200 multi-specialty physicians, and a team of 230 volunteers keep the hospital going with their dedication to quality and excellence.
